#37014c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#37014c is composed of 21.6% red, 0.4%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.6% cyan, 98.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 70.2% black. It has a hue angle of 283.2 degrees, a saturation of 97.4% and a lightness of 15.1%. #37014c color hex could be obtained by blending #6e0298 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

Shades and Tints of #37014c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0012 is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.
